Untawa is a Rural village located in Sirauli-gauspur, Bara-banki, Uttar-pradesh.

The total population of Untawa is 1,062.

Untawa village comprises 180 households.

The literacy rate in Untawa is 52.6%. Among the literate population of 463, there are 279 literate males and 184 literate females.

In Untawa, there are 534 males and 528 females, with a sex ratio of 989 females per 1000 males.

There are 182 children (17.1% of population), comprising 87 boys and 95 girls.

The total number of workers in Untawa is 406, with 287 main workers and 119 marginal workers.

In Untawa, there are 68 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(40 males, 28 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).

Untawa is located in Uttar-pradesh state, Bara-banki district, and falls under Sirauli-gauspur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 164991 and LGD code is 164991.
